Rules
- In a school club, club or at home, the team solves the task independently and on time and submits its solution on these pages.
- The solution can be submitted only after the team has registered or logged in on these pages in the top right corner
- Team members are up to 18 years old (on September 1, 2026, they must not be older than 18). Each contestant may contribute to the solutions of only one team in each round, but changing team members between rounds is not prohibited.
- The team has an adult supervisor who is responsible for the team's activities and the uploaded content, but does not assist the contestants in solving the tasks (unless they are also a team member). This means that the supervisor does not suggest ideas for solutions, does not participate in the development of the mechanical design or the program, but may help contestants overcome technical obstacles on a general level.
We kindly ask team supervisors to maintain their integrity by adhering to this rule. - The solution contains:
- a description of the solution with a list of the components used and how they are connected
- a group photo of your team,
- a photo of the robot showing how it is constructed
- the program and 3D model files
- and a video showing how the robot solves the task
- The use of artificial intelligence when solving the tasks is permitted, but it must be disclosed in the submitted solution – what tools were used and for what specific purpose.
- You may use any electronic components from the kit, any 3D parts from the kit, or parts you design and print yourself. Extra rubber bands, strings and springs are allowed; otherwise, consult the judges in advance unless the task statement specifies otherwise.
- Your solution will receive 0-3 points in the overall league ranking - of the two tasks, the one for which you receive the better evaluation will count. You may solve both; we will also record the unused points and somehow reward them at the end.
- The competition is evaluated in two categories - Explorers (simpler tasks) and Pioneers (more demanding tasks)
- Solutions are evaluated by a group of independent judges.
- If the task seems difficult, simplify it as needed! We are also interested in partial solutions, and you can receive at least some of the points.
- The purpose of the competition is not to defeat others, but to pursue your creative hobby, learn as much as possible together, and have some fun along the way.
How do we evaluate?
Your solutions will be carefully reviewed and evaluated, in accordance with the instructions for the given task, by Jozef, Paľo and Rišo – the organizers of the original Robot League:

Jozef Vaško
Richard Balogh
Pavel Petrovič
Each of them independently assigns 0-3 points according to whether the solution is complete (contains pictures, a video, the program, a good description, and the robot does what it is supposed to do) and how much it impresses them. The arithmetic mean will count in the table. We evaluate the Slovak and international rankings separately.
The Kit
- it was developed by Sebastián Horváth from FMFI UK in 2025 - 2026 as his bachelor's thesis and by a team of collaborators
- it contains around 300 plastic 3D-printed parts, an RP2350 control unit with a support board and 17 kinds of other electronic components, a set of screws and nuts, wheels and a caster ball, LiIon batteries with a holder and charger, cables, pliers and a screwdriver set
- according to the instructions, 4 different robots can be built - an explorer, a line follower, a maze mouse and a manipulator with an arm
